Black and Latino Coloradans are being disproportionately hit by monkeypox as cases rise

Summary by Ground News
As of Thursday, the state has confirmed 168 cases in Colorado, stretching back to May. Nearly 12% of infections are in people who are Black, while about 34% of people testing positive identify as Hispanic or Latino. People between the ages of 25 and 44 make up roughly 75% of the state's cases.
